Light And Late
So the theme for the first week is going to be 'light and late', with an emphasis on motivational strategies. In the past I haven't really been the best at motivating Chase, so to speak, and I haven't been quiet enough in my phases for him. The emphasized little issues that are going to be focused on are going to be his cinchiness and his sourness to being mounted. I created cinchiness in him by being too quick to tighten his girth, and I originally created sourness in being mounted by being too unfairly particular in how he offers his back to me. Going at it slow and right this time will hopefully make a difference over the next week. Riding games will be passenger and follow the rail with point to point, and online games will be point to point with focus from zones three/four/five.
